Amicus curiae: achievements, prospects, challenges

The international conference Amicus Curiae: Achievements, Perspectives, Challenges took place on 14-15 October 2019. The conference aimed to promote the institution of amicus curiae, present best practices regarding the application of the amicus curiae mechanism in domestic and international proceedings, discuss existing problems and challenges related to the application of this legal instrument, as well as exchange experiences and establish cooperation between the event participants. The many conference sessions were devoted to discussing the role of strategic litigation in the Polish legal system and the challenges faced by NGOs and lawyers involved in strategic litigation in the defence of human rights.

On 16 October 2019, a series of follow-up meetings were held to bring together various Polish legal projects launched by members of different legal professions in response to the constitutional crisis and the crisis of the rule of law. Meetings with representatives of the Bar were also held.

The conference was organised with the support of foreign partners: the Sankt-Petersburg-based social organisation Civic Control (Russia), the Belarusian Helsinki Committee and Human Rights Centre “Vesna” (Belarus), Ukrainian Helsinki Human Rights Union and Human Rights Education House in Chernihiv (Ukraine). The conference is sponsored by the Ministry of Foreign Affairs, Solidarity Fund PL and the Human Rights House Foundation. The Commissioner for Human Rights has become the honorary sponsor of the event. The first conference day was organised in collaboration with the Law Clinic of the Faculty of Law and Administration of the University of Warsaw.

The event featured the presentation of a game and animated film explaining what the amicus curiae is and how to use this measure to engage in the process of defending human rights.
